B-Tech survey on Aug 18th 2011, 07:32 peeps

Hi there, first off I am the hugest plush fan ever and it’s great to see someone taking a commercial interest in it on a tertiary level. That said, I don’t think you can use these kinds of questions to create the ultimate plush that will sell. Plush, like their sibling items the vinyl toy, depends heavily on intuitive emotional investment from the consumers side. It is not something formulaic, although some characteristics have consistently done well since the inception of the concept of the modern toy, and you either have a knack at it or you don’t. I just feel these questions you ask are only good for a questionaire type thesis, and if that’s what you are doing then I wish you luck, otherwise if not I’d say drop the questions and look up academic research done on product design (there’s tons of info out there, my thesis touched upon alot of them).

how important is Aug 18th 2011, 07:32 peeps

I cannot agree with you more. T-shirt design, as with any other discipline of design or art, relies on contextual relevance and appropriateness. Some colours that work for a design may not work for others. Sometimes you may get a design that will only work with ONE colour t-shirt and nothing else. That’s not to say that that design is deemed as inferior to those that are more flexible with t-shirt colour, that just means you have to be observant enough to know it beforehand and make certain that your design is reproduced on other colours if they really don’t work. I have seen designs made on multiple colour t-shirts that just do not work with it, and that is poor judgement. I’d rather have my design produced in a single t-shirt colour than a dozen and have eleven ugly combinations floating around out in the world…
